Thermal sensor compatibility WD 1TB - Seagate SSHD 1TB

Hi,

I was changing the hd drive of my imac 27" mid 2010 because de original one failed. I bought a Seagate SSHD 1Tb to put instead. I was not able to see which was the original HD until I opened 5 minutes ago. I chose the Seagate because I read about its compatibility with my imac mid 2010. Well, the problem is that the thermal sensor connector (8 pins) does not fit in the Seagate (4 pins). I also read about the OWC kit, is that the only solution for this?

Can anyone help me with this?

thanks!!
